Cebu Uphill Tour

Living in a city can be stressful. At times we just need to escape city life, be one with nature, chill and unwind. Luckily in Cebu, you can easily get away and explore the mountain resorts, restaurants and attractions that are just along the Transcentral Highway with an hour or less.

These are the few which I have explored on a day trip.

WEST 35

A perfect venue if you’re looking for a chill place to enjoy good food (farm to table) and the mountain side. The resort is only a few meters away from the popular attractions in Balamban like Adventure Cafe, Buwakan ni Alejandra, and Florentino’s.

Afternoon chill ain’t enough? They also have available rooms for you to use for an overnight stay.

JVR ISLAND IN THE SKY

A mountain resort, with a perfectly manicured garden and a colorful hanging bridge and a cable car, and of course a pool

With an entrance fee of only P50 for adults and P25 for kids, guests can already enjoy a wide range of outdoor activities while staying at the mountain resort.

They also have available rooms with kitchen and dining and cottages for you to rent, while enjoying the cool breeze.

  • Open Cottages: ₱350 per day
  • Cable Car: ₱150 per head
  • Swimming Pool: ₱50 per head

BUWAKAN NI ALEJANDRA

A vibrant garden, filled with different species flowering plants.

  • Environmental Fee: ₱5 per head
  • Entrance Fee: ₱50 per adult, ₱20 per child, ₱25 for PWD & Senior Citizen
  • Operating hours: 7AM to 6PM, Mondays to Sundays.

FLORENTINO’S ECO PARK

Dubbed as the Little Tagaytay of Cebu primarily because of its chill and cozy outdoor ambiance – the breathtaking view and the foggy weather.

Operating hours: 6AM to 7PM, Mondays to Sundays (Best time to go: 6-7AM & 4-6PM)

TERRAZAS DE FLORES

Cebu have it’s on take of rice terraces, but instead of rice crops, the ones that are being planted are different species of plants and flowers. The place also has cozy cabanas and a restaurant.

TOPS LOOKOUT

A viewing deck that offers the city view. With a cavern like structure with tables and chair you can use.

TEMPLE OF LEAH

The temple has an art gallery, museum, and a library where all of the favorite things her wife owned are placed. At the top, there’s a spectacular view of the city and more exceptional scenery as you walk through the temple. In this Greek methodology-inspired mansion, you will feel that you are already in a different place, lets say the land of the gods? there are also gigantic lions or as I call it guard dogs which I have named Aurum and Argentum lying on each side of the stairs that will guide you to the door step of another jaw-dropping view. You can see a grand staircase with angels made up of brass and the Queen of the Temple in about 10-ft statue with crown and flower.

HOW TO GET TO THESE PLACES?

Take a V-hire from the Ayala Center Terminal going to Balamban via Transcentral highway route. Fare is P120 per person (one-way). Inform the driver to drop you off to your preferred destination.

You may also hire a habal-habal at JY mall. But I prefer booking a habal-habal through kuya Jade Codera, as some of the habal-habal drivers are taking advantage of tourist when it comes to how much they charge.
